Wells, ME Other AttractionsMore than 2 miles of white sand beach that is great for families. Kids can explore the tidal pools and splash in the surf. Public restrooms available at Wells Recreational Area, Atlantic Avenue (Eastern Shore area), Wells Harbor and Wells Beach (Casino Square)
